How much does it cost to rent an apartment in Sunny Isles Beach?
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
---|---|---|---|
Sunny Isles Beach Studio Apartments | $2,514 | $1,250 | $4,000 |
Sunny Isles Beach 1 Bedroom Apartments | $2,834 | $1,309 | $8,500 |
Sunny Isles Beach 2 Bedroom Apartments | $3,490 | $1,700 | $10,000+ |
Sunny Isles Beach 3 Bedroom Apartments | $5,687 | $2,300 | $10,000+ |
Sunny Isles Beach 4 Bedroom Apartments | $21,370 | $2,500 | $10,000+ |

Getting Around Sunny Isles Beach, FL
Walk Score®
70 / 100
Very Walkable
Most errands can be accomplished on foot
Bike Score®
57 / 100
Bikeable
Some bike infrastructure
Transit Score®
45 / 100
Some Transit
A few nearby public transportation options
What Are Walk Score®, Transit Score®, and Bike Score® Ratings?
- Walk Score® measures the walkability of any address.
- Transit Score® measures access to public transit.
- Bike Score® measures the bikeability of any address.
Frequently Asked Questions about Sunny Isles Beach
How much are Studio apartments in Sunny Isles Beach?
There are currently 36 Studio Apartments in Sunny Isles Beach with rent ranges from $1,250 to $4,000 with an average price of $2,514.
What is the current price range for One Bedroom Sunny Isles Beach Apartments for rent?
Today's rental pricing for One Bedroom Apartments in Sunny Isles Beach ranges from $1,309 to $8,500 with an average monthly rent of $2,834.
What does renting a Two Bedroom Apartment in Sunny Isles Beach cost?
The monthly rent prices of Two Bedroom Apartments currently available in Sunny Isles Beach range from $1,700 to $10,600. Today's average rental price for Two Bedrooms here is $3,490.
How expensive are Sunny Isles Beach Three Bedroom Apartments?
There are currently 95 Three Bedroom Apartments listings available in Sunny Isles Beach on ApartmentHomeLiving.com. The pricing ranges from $2,300 to $20,400 - averaging $5,687 for the location.
